AI Summary
-
Establishes a statute of repose prohibiting civil actions against professional land surveyors or real property owners if 10 years have elapsed since the later of contract completion or final payment for land surveying work.
-
Adds a new section to chapter 464, Hawaii Revised Statutes, to codify the 10-year repose period for land surveying claims.
-
Addresses the disparity in legal protections between land surveyors and other design professionals (engineers and architects) who are covered under chapter 672B design claims provisions.
-
Takes effect on July 1, 2050.
